Tenstorrent is seeking a SoC Design Verification Engineer to help validate next-generation multi-chip and chiplet-based SoCs especially with Die-to-Die (D2D). You will work on test development, debug, and infrastructure that ensure robust, high-performance silicon for AI and high-compute applications. This is a hands-on role at the forefront of verification for cutting-edge semiconductor systems.

This role is hybrid, based out of Ottawa, ON.

We welcome candidates at various experience levels for this role. During the interview process, candidates will be assessed for the appropriate level, and offers will align with that level, which may differ from the one in this posting.

Who You Are

  • Skilled in SystemVerilog, SV-UVM, and Python with proven verification experience.
  • Familiar with AI-assisted coding tools like Copilot, Cursor, or Claude to accelerate DV workflows.
  • Comfortable writing detailed test plans, building infrastructure, and debugging complex issues.
  • Collaborative engineer who thrives in cross-functional, fast-paced environments.

What We Need

  • Develop and maintain D2D tests and supporting verification infrastructure.
  • Write, execute, and track test plans for SoC, chiplet, and multi-chip designs.
  • Triage, analyze, and debug issues in collaboration with design and architecture teams.
  • Leverage modern AI tools to enhance verification productivity and coverage.
  • Firmware co-sim with RTL and CPU core debug experience preferred

What You Will Learn

  • Gain experience with advanced verification flows for chiplet and multi-die SoCs.
  • Work with emerging standards like UCIe and BoW for die-to-die interconnect.
  • Explore co-simulation methodologies with frameworks such as Cocotb.
  • Build expertise in the intersection of AI tools and state-of-the-art verification practices.

Tenstorrent is a next-generation computing company that builds computers for AI.

Headquartered in the U.S. with offices in Austin, Texas, and Silicon Valley, and global offices in Toronto, Belgrade, Seoul, Tokyo, and Bangalore, Tenstorrent brings together experts in the field of computer architecture, ASIC design, RISC-V technology, advanced systems, and neural network compilers. Tenstorrent is backed by Eclipse Ventures and Real Ventures, Archerman Capital, Samsung Catalyst Fund, and Hyundai Motor Group among others.
